XCMG Launches First Silk Road E-Commerce Station, XCMG-PNG, Offering One-Stop Equipment Purchases in South Pacific Regions
PR94009
XUZHOU, China, Jan. 11, 2022 /PRNewswire=KYODO JBN/ --
XCMG Papua New Guinea (XCMG-PNG), the first Silk Road E-Commerce Station by
XCMG (SZ:000425), is officially online to provide one-stop service experience
for construction machinery customers and users in the South Pacific and
surrounding regions with Papua New Guinea as the center, guaranteeing smoother,
more professional customized and localized services. Orders placed on XCMG-PNG
can avail of direct customs declaration by XCMG.
XCMG released its Silk Road E-Commerce development strategy on December 27,
2021, which plans to open localized e-commerce websites in 10 countries in the
next five years, including Papua New Guinea, Indonesia and Russia, to meet the
demands of local customers. The stations will fully utilize the overseas
channel resources of XCMG to construct local station clusters with the
cross-border e-commerce platforms as the core.
"We'll actively promote the construction of cross-border supply chain platforms
to establish a new foreign trade model that integrates a 'cross-border
e-commerce platform, foreign trade integrated service platform and public
overseas warehouses,' offering an all-process solution for both buyers and
sellers to realize the localization of language, marketing, currency, logistics
and services to be better in line with customers' needs," said Zhang Yanmei,
General Manager of XCMG E-Commerce.
XCMG-PNG currently carries 7,121 units of equipment products online, including
18 first-level categories and 241 subdivided categories.
The Silk Road E-Commerce stations will further empower not only XCMG, but all
Chinese brands to embrace the international market. As of now, the proprietary
sales of XCMG E-Commerce are over 1.8 billion yuan (US$282 million), serving 18
level-1 industries and 1.5 million industry customers. The cross-border
e-commerce platform covers 219 countries and regions in terms of inquiries,
with products exported to 140 countries and regions.
"We've established two e-commerce clusters for domestic and overseas markets,
forming a '4+11' matrix which is composed of four integrated mechanical and
electrical trade service platforms – Tlang, Machmall, XCMG secondhand
e-commerce platform and Gongbing Cloud pare parts e-commerce platform, as well
as 11 vertical e-commerce platforms for XCMG's professional products," said
Zhang.
XCMG carries out 9710 and 9810 B2B export businesses on its cross-border,
e-commerce platform, and has established six public overseas warehouses in
India, Kenya, the Philippines, Turkey, U.S. and Russia to provide strong
support for fragmented foreign trade orders.
